Chloris.earth is a pioneering startup operating in the natural capital space, providing innovative solutions to help global economies transition towards a net-zero future. The company's primary offering is the Chloris Platform, a cutting-edge tool that uses advanced machine learning (ML) and artificial intelligence (AI) to generate comprehensive biomass maps. These maps, created from spaceborne LiDAR samples, provide valuable insights into changes in biomass stock over time.

The Chloris Platform serves a diverse range of clients, including environmental agencies, conservation organizations, and businesses seeking to adopt nature-based solutions. The platform's unique selling point is its ability to rapidly produce detailed biomass maps on a large scale, offering clients a high level of accuracy and integrity.

Chloris.earth operates in the growing market of environmental data analytics. The company's business model revolves around its proprietary technology, which combines active and passive Earth Observation data with ancillary data to produce predictive features. These features form the basis of the company's mapping algorithms, which are then used to generate the biomass maps.

The company generates revenue by selling access to its platform and the insights derived from its data. Clients can use these insights to make informed decisions about their environmental strategies, helping them to achieve their sustainability goals and contribute to a net-zero future.
